Hey — quick handover from Priya to Tomás on SDK parity. The Quillwork Android SDK finally matches iOS on offline caching and retry policies, but batch uploads still lag behind. New folks: don't assume a feature exists on both sides just because the docs say so. We track every gap in a living matrix, updated weekly. You'll find it at the page linked below.

dashboard of baweg-bawip = https://kibana.qirvancloud.test/run/projects/job/secrets/503e59c4ba058b95

TURN-208: Gatevale turnstile counters at the Merrow Field pilot double-count when a rotation reverses mid-cycle. Attendance totals drift roughly 2% high per event. The debounce window fix is implemented, reviewed by Ilsa, and soak-tested across two simulated match days without drift. Ready for your cut; the candidate build is identified below.

trace token, tagag-tafog: htk6_5ed18c

# Session Handling — TimeGrid Solver

The Larchwood timetable solver keeps solver sessions server-side; clients hold only an opaque session key. Sessions expire after 30 minutes idle and are never persisted across restarts. Reviewers should verify no session state leaks into solver logs. For local review against the sandbox, authenticate with the token below.

session JWT of yawep-yawep = eyJhbGciOiJIUzI1NiIsInR5cCI6IkpXVCJ9.eyJzdWIiOiI3pWF3_In0.aXYsHiog

**Onboarding: CSV Import Wizard (Sheetfall)**

New folks joining the sync: the Sheetfall import wizard handles all bulk customer uploads. It validates headers, normalizes dates, and queues rows into Ledgepipe for processing. Most of your early tickets will involve malformed delimiter handling, so read the parser notes first. To run the wizard locally you need access to the Ledgepipe staging queue, which requires authenticating with the key shown below.

service key, fawip-bajef: kto11_Qt5wZK9vdNC